Automatically Number Rows in Excel

Wednesday, June 3rd, 2009

Unlike other Microsoft programs such as Word, Excel does not have a button to automatically number data. However, you can easily number your data by using the fill handle to fill a series.

Accessing toolbars in Project

Monday, January 5th, 2009

By default, Microsoft Project displays both the standard and formatting toolbars on one line. The result is that there is not enough room on the screen to display all the needed buttons, so the user wastes a lot of time searching for them.
